In an antiflourite structure, cations occupy

A

Centre of cube

B

Tetrahedral voids

C

Corners of cube

D

Octahedral voids

Text Solution

Verified by Experts

The correct Answer is:
B

In an antifluorite structure, metal ion (cation) fill half of the tetrahedral voids .
